身びいき (みびいき) Japanese meaning | Kotomora
Meanings 1
noun, noun or participle which takes 'suru', transitive verb
favoritism ; nepotism
Refers to showing unfair preference to someone because of a personal connection, such as family or close friends. Often used in contexts like hiring, promotions, or evaluations.

Written forms 身み びいき
Common mixed kanji-kana spelling. The kanji 身 means 'body/oneself', and びいき is usually written in kana.
身贔屓みびいき
Full kanji spelling using the rare character 贔屓. Seldom used in modern writing.
Kanji 身 somebody, person, one's station in life Etymology Compound of 身 (mi, 'oneself, one's own') and 贔屓 (hiiki, 'favor, patronage'). The second element is often written in kana as びいき.
